我正在使用bottlenose从Amazon提取产品价格,从Amazon.com
中提取的情况正常,我尝试将搜索扩展到Amazon.co.uk
,我在Amazon.co.uk
中申请了一个关联帐户,并获得了一个新的associate-id
amazon_search = bottlenose.Amazon(str(aws_key.aws_access_key),
str(aws_key.aws_secret_key),
str(aws_key.aws_associate_key),
MaxQPS=0.9)
item_details = BeautifulStoneSoup(amazon_search.ItemLookup(ItemId=item_asin.text,ResponseGroup="OfferSummary")
我使用了上面的代码,为什么即使在我更改了associate_key
之后,Amazon.com
和{
列出
amazon_search
类中的属性将告诉您原因:将属性
Region
添加到您想要的任何区域都可以解决问题。刚测试过,效果很好。在相关问题 更多 >
编程相关推荐